President Goodluck Jonathan has assured journalists in the country that they will enjoy utmost freedom and constitutional rights more than ever before under his administration.

The president made the pledge while speaking at the opening ceremony of the national delegate’s conference of the Nigerian Union of Journalists pledged to have nothing to do with anyone who breaches the rights of journalists in the country.

He called on the media to put the interest of the nation first as well as rise above manipulations by politicians.

He requested members of the fourth estate of the realm to cross check their facts before publication and also to be mindful of those who use the media to promote their selfish interests.

The theme for this year’s conference is ‘Transforming Societies through Media Freedom.’

National officers for the union will be elected at the conference which will have 846 delegates participating in.

42 members are contesting the various national offices of the union.
